Appeal Home Shading is getting ready to showcase some of its newest products and stylish shading solutions at Grand Designs Live at London’s ExCel in May.

Running for nine days, the show offers visitors a unique opportunity to see all the latest trends for the home and numerous products that have never been seen before. Presented by design guru Kevin McCloud, the event will be packed with over 500 exhibitors, across seven different sections.

New for Appeal in 2015 is an updated range of window and door blinds designed to suit the latest trends in windows and doors.

With bi-fold doors becoming increasingly popular in many homes, Appeal’s bespoke roller blinds or Honeycomb Energy Saver blinds for bi-fold and double doors will reduce the sun’s glare from outside and keep rooms cool in the summer months.   In winter they will help reduce heat loss and provide privacy for the darker evenings. The blinds retract discreetly away when not in use to provide a full and unobstructed view.

In addition, Appeal’s Lantern Roof blinds offer a practical and stylish solution, helping to control light, reduce glare and maintain an ambient temperature level. Fully remote controlled, they are perfect for reducing glare on TVs and screens.  Available in blackout fabrics making the blinds ideal for bedrooms and cinema rooms.

Appeal also offer the ClearView pleated blind for gable end windows, an area that has been traditionally difficult to shade. These unique blinds provide an attractive and functional solution to cover large unusually shaped areas of glass. Pleated conservatory blinds retract neatly when not required, leaving an unobstructed view.

Grand Design Show visitors will also be able to see the new Varalux shading blinds, which offer style and ingenuity to provide complete flexibility over light, shade and privacy. Using two different fabrics that rotate on a roller tube, a simple chain control adjusts the shading from translucent to opaque depending on requirements.

Information will also be available on Haus Verandas; a stylish solution for anyone that wants to spend more time outdoors and extend their home into the garden. A Haus Veranda has a glass roof that offers protection whatever the weather. Optional additions, including a side screen to provide shelter from the wind, as well as remote controlled LED lighting and halogen heating, mean you can enjoy your outdoor space late into the evening. For those hot summer days an integral awning will provide shade.  Designed with high quality laminated safety glass and corrosion proof aluminium profiles, the range offers 56 standard colours and a further 150 colour options to suit any surroundings. Haus Exteriors, part of the Appeal Group, will also be showcasing the popular Haus awnings alongside their verandas, another option to help you enjoy outdoor living throughout the spring and summer.

Design lovers will also be able to access ideas and inspiration on popular shading solutions from Appeal’s extensive range of bespoke conservatory blinds and window shutters. Choose from the timeless woven wood style of Original French Pinoleum or innovative Alu-Pleat® and Solar R® pleated and roller blinds, offering unrivalled heat reflection to help keep conservatories cool and comfortable. Or view Appeal’s range of individually handcrafted window shutters. Made to-order in a choice of styles and finishes with colour-matching available, the shutters are a contemporary way of controlling light and privacy, making them the ideal alternative to traditional net curtains or blinds.
